Here is a nice homemade Mojito recipe for your special occasions..



Ingredients
White rum
top up sparkling water
Mint sprigs
Ice cubes
Lime slice
Sugar





Mash the mint and sugar together. Add the (dark or light) rum and lime juice and pour over the ice.

Top up with sparkling water. Use a highball glass. I think the best way to combine ingredients for your tastes.
